The Top Indicator if You Want To Know Where Mortgage Rates Are Heading

Woman standing at desk over laptop with view of backyard

Mortgage rates have increased significantly since the beginning of the year. Each Thursday, Freddie Mac releases its Primary Mortgage Market Survey. According to the latest survey, the average 30-year fixed-rate mortgage has risen from 3.22% at the start of the year to 3.55% as of last week.
